Responsibilities:
- Perform preventative maintenance, inspections, diagnostics, and repairs on electric, propane, diesel, and gas-powered forklifts and material handling equipment
- Troubleshoot and repair hydraulic, electrical, mechanical, steering, brake, drive train, and propane systems
- Diagnose equipment failures using diagnostic software, testing equipment, and service manuals
- Complete scheduled maintenance programs to minimize customer equipment downtime
- Repair and replace defective components, assemblies, and parts
- Conduct equipment safety inspections and ensure all repairs meet manufacturer and safety standards
- Accurately complete work orders, service reports, and maintenance documentation
- Communicate effectively with customers regarding equipment condition, required repairs, and maintenance recommendations
- Operate a company service vehicle while maintaining tools, equipment, and inventory
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ment while following all company safety policies and procedures
- Stay current with new forklift technologies, manufacturer updates, and industry best practices
